【问题标题】:Pulling data from another website从另一个网站提取数据
【发布时间】:2013-08-03 23:58:14
【问题描述】:

我正在构建一个故障排除站点,并且正在寻找一种直接从 OEM 网站提取信息的方法。一个示例是直接来自 HTC 的 Droid DNA 的主重置说明。我知道我可以使用 iFrame,但如果 HTC 更新 URL,iFrame 就会被冲洗掉。 JS 中是否有脚本可以自动“抓取”这些 OEM 网站?我在 PHP 中看到了很多示例,但正在寻找 HTML 或 JS 中的解决方案。

【问题讨论】:

    标签: javascript html web web-scraping


    【解决方案1】:

    您可以使用 javascript 对数据发出 GET 请求。

    使用 jQuery 执行此操作的一些链接: http://api.jquery.com/load/(见http://api.jquery.com/load/#loading-page-fragments
    http://api.jquery.com/jQuery.ajax/
    http://api.jquery.com/jQuery.get/

    请注意,资产的相对链接可能会损坏,如果您要加载包括等在内的整个页面,则应将其放在 iframe 中。我看不出这种方法比使用 iframe 有什么好处,因为如果内容的 URL 发生变化,它仍然无法工作。

    【讨论】:

      猜你喜欢
      • 2013-08-15
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2019-04-22
      • 2018-04-03
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      相关资源
      最近更新 更多